www.snopes.com/photos/animals/luckycoyote.aspMeet the wiliest of all coyotes: Hit by a car at 75 mph, embedded in the fender, rode for 600 miles and SURVIVED! When a brother and sister struck a coyote at 75 mph they assumed they had killed the animal and drove on. They didn't realize this was the toughest creature ever to survive a hit-and-run. Eight hours, two fuel stops, and 600 miles later they found the wild animal embedded in their front fender - and very much alive.Follow the link for pics.
